摘要
设计一对能区分经典株与变异株的PRRSV特异性引物,建立PRRSV经典株与变异株的鉴别诊断方法,用该方法对2013年实验室收集到的来自131个免疫PRRS弱毒疫苗猪场的493份临床送检样品进行RT-PCR检测。PRRSV的检出率为27.2%(134/493),其中变异株的检出率为23.1%(114/493),经典株的检出率为8.11%(40/493),20份样品可以同时检出PRRSV变异株和经典株,检出率为4.1%(20/493)。对临床送检的30个免疫PRRS活疫苗猪场的62个猪群1 079份血清,用IDEXX PRRS X3抗体检测试剂盒进行了血清学分析,结果显示总体阳性率为91.01%(982/1079),育肥猪群阳性率最高,达95.26%;其次为母猪群,阳性率高达93.7%;保育猪相对较低,为82.72%。根据猪群临床症状和PRRS状况将猪群分为四种类型。对62个免疫PRRS弱毒疫苗的规模化猪场进行了抗体分析,PRRSV抗体的离散度超过40%的猪场达59.7%(37/62)。这些结果说明,变异株为主要流行毒株,同时存在经典株与变异株的混合感染;免疫猪群抗体不整齐,目前弱毒疫苗免疫效果不理想。
PRRSV specific primers and identify primers (the distinction between the classical strains and HP-PRRSV) were designed respectively. In 2013, our laboratory detected 493 clinical samples by using RT-PCR method for PRRSV epidemiological investigation. The results showed that the PRRSV positive rate was 27.2% (134/493), while HP-PRRSV positive rate was 23.1% (114/493), the classic strains positive rate was 8.11% (40/493), part of the pig farms can be simultaneously detected with the HP-PRRSV and classical strains (20/493)of one sample. It shows the co-existence of HP- PRRSV with classical strains, however, HP-PRRSV was superiority pandemic strain. Furthermore, we tested 1079 serum samples with IDEXX PRRS X3 Antibody Test Kit for PRRSV serological analysis, it shows that the overall PRRSV antibody positive rate was 91.01% (982/1 079). Positive rate of growing and fattening pigs is the highest, 95.26%. Followed by the sow group, 93.7%, and the nursery pigs are the lowest, 82.72%. According to the clinical symptoms, PRRS pigs can be divided into four types. The analysis of 62 large-scale pig farms shows the coefficient of variation of sow herds PRRSV antibody of 59.7% (37/62) pig farms is over 40%. The survey results show PRRS is still quite active and unstable in most of the herds.
